What is bioprocess development?

Bioprocess development is the process of designing, optimizing, and scaling up methods to produce biological products such as vaccines, antibodies, enzymes, or biofuels using living cells or their components. This field involves activities like selecting the best microorganisms or cell lines, optimizing growth conditions, and developing purification steps to ensure product quality and quantity. Bioprocess development is essential in industries like pharmaceuticals, biotechnology, and agriculture for bringing laboratory discoveries into commercial-scale production. Professionals in this area work closely with research scientists and engineers to translate lab-scale processes into manufacturing protocols. The ultimate goal is to create efficient, cost-effective, and reproducible production methods for biologics.

What are the key skills and qualifications needed to thrive in Bioprocess Development, and why are they important?

To thrive in Bioprocess Development, you need a strong background in biology, chemistry, and process engineering, typically supported by a degree in biotechnology, biochemical engineering, or a related field. Familiarity with bioreactors, cell culture techniques, analytical instrumentation, and regulatory standards such as GMP is essential. Critical thinking, problem-solving, and effective collaboration are vital soft skills for optimizing processes and addressing complex production challenges. These skills ensure efficient scale-up, quality control, and innovation in the development of biologics and other bioproducts.

What are some typical challenges faced in a Bioprocess Development role, and how are they addressed?

Professionals in Bioprocess Development often encounter challenges such as optimizing process parameters for scalability, maintaining product consistency, and troubleshooting unexpected variability during production runs. To address these, teams rely on rigorous experimental design, data analysis, and close collaboration with upstream and downstream processing teams. Effective communication and adaptability are crucial, as protocols may need rapid adjustment in response to new findings or regulatory requirements. Continual learning and cross-functional teamwork are key to overcoming these challenges and ensuring successful process development.

What is the difference between Bioprocess Development vs Bioprocess Manufacturing?

AspectBioprocess DevelopmentBioprocess Manufacturing
CredentialsDegree in Biotechnology, Bioengineering, or related fieldsSimilar credentials, often with additional certifications in GMP or quality assurance
Work EnvironmentLaboratory and pilot plant settings focused on process design and optimizationProduction facilities focused on large-scale manufacturing
Industry UsageEarly-stage process design, scale-up, and validationLarge-scale production, process execution, and quality control

Bioprocess Development focuses on designing and optimizing processes in labs and pilot plants, while Bioprocess Manufacturing involves large-scale production and process execution. Both roles require similar educational backgrounds but differ in their focus and work environment.

The Scientist III will help define and deliver a practical bioprocess digital twin roadmap, including data strategy, model development, validation, deployment, and cross-functional adoption. This role offers the opportunity to work with advanced technologies while contributing to our mission of enabling customers to make the world healthier, cleaner, and safer.
Responsibilities
  • Lead development of digital twin models for CHO cell culture and upstream bioprocess workflows, including fed-batch and perfusion applications.
  • Build predictive simulation capabilities for nutrient depletion, metabolite accumulation, cell growth, productivity, process drift, CQAs, and scale-up behavior.
  • Develop hybrid modeling workflows that combine mechanistic approaches such as stoichiometric modeling, kinetic modeling, MFA/FBA, and mass balance methods with AI, machine learning, and Bayesian optimization.
  • Enable virtual experimentation by simulating candidate feed strategies, pH strategies, temperature shifts, and other process conditions to prioritize the most promising experimental paths.
  • Define data requirements, validation strategies, model governance practices, and success criteria for predictive and simulation-based workflows.
  • Support real-time or near-real-time forecasting use cases by incorporating bioreactor and process data to detect deviations early and recommend corrective actions.
